#1d0da4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d0da4 is composed of 11.4% red, 5.1% green and 64.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.3% cyan, 92.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 35.7% black. It has a hue angle of 246.4 degrees, a saturation of 85.3% and a lightness of 34.7%. #1d0da4 color hex could be obtained by blending #3a1aff with #000049.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

#1d0da4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d0da4 has RGB values of R:29, G:13, B:164 and CMYK values of C:0.82, M:0.92, Y:0, K:0.36. Its decimal value is 1904036.

Shades and Tints of #1d0da4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#efedf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1d0da4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#585859 is the less saturated color, while #1806ab is the most saturated one.
